Understanding Warped Server Mechanics

The Warped Server operates on a 90-day seasonal cycle, designed to keep the competition fresh and balanced. Each season introduces new challenges, rewards, and meta-shifts. The core mechanic involves a "soft reset" where player levels, weapon proficiency, and enhancement tiers are partially adjusted to ensure a level playing field.

Seasonal Transition Process

During the transition period (usually 24 hours of downtime), the server processes the reset. According to our data mined from the Warped Server Release Date patch notes, the following occurs:

  • Player Level: Reduced to a baseline (e.g., Level 50) regardless of previous cap.
  • Weapon Mastery: Retained but with a 30% reduction in experience points.
  • Enhancement Materials: Carried over fully, encouraging strategic hoarding.

Deep Dive: Weapons & Enhancements Retention

This is the heart of the matter. After extensive player surveys and data collection from the User Center, we've compiled definitive answers.

Weapon Retention Policy

All weapons acquired during a season remain in your inventory permanently. Yes, you read that right! Whether you pulled a rare SSR weapon or crafted a legendary one, it will not be deleted. However, the weapon's enhancement level and star rating may be scaled down to align with the new season's power curve.

For example, a weapon enhanced to +15 might be reduced to +10. This prevents power creep and ensures competitive balance. Players are compensated with "Seasonal Tokens" that can be used to accelerate re-enhancement in the new season.

Enhancement Materials and Currency

Enhancement materials (e.g., upgrade modules, cores) and in-game currency (like Gold and Dark Crystals) are fully retained. This is a crucial strategic element: smart players stockpile materials toward the end of a season to gain an early advantage in the next.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: Will my purchased cosmetics be deleted?

A: No, all cosmetics and skins are permanently retained across seasons.

Q: How does the partial reset affect matchmaking?

A: Matchmaking uses a hidden MMR that is only slightly adjusted, so you'll still face players of similar skill.

Q: Can I transfer items from Warped Server to regular servers?

A: No, Warped Server is isolated. However, your account progress on the User Center is shared for tracking.
